LT Debt to Total Assets is a measurement representing the percentage of a corporation's assets that are financed with loans and financial obligations lasting more than one year. The ratio provides a general measure of the financial position of a company, including its ability to meet financial requirements for outstanding loans. It is calculated as a company's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ligationdivide by its Total Assets. Global Insurance  (DHA:GLOBALINS) LT-Debt-to-Total-Asset Explanation

LT Debt to Total Asset is a measurement representing the percentage of a corporation's assets that are financed with loans and financial obligations lasting more than one year. The ratio provides a general measure of the financial position of a company, including its ability to meet financial requirements for outstanding loans. A year-over-year decrease in this metric would suggest the company is progressively becoming less dependent on debt to grow their business.

Global Insurance Ltd is a Bangladesh-based non-life insurance company engaged in offering general insurance products and services. The Company has five primary business segments for reporting purpose namely Fire, Marine Cargo, Marine Hull, Motor, and Miscellaneous. The Principal object of the company is to carry out all kinds of insurance, guarantee, and indemnity business other than life insurance business.
